package torrentpotato
import (
"encoding/json"
"net/http"
"github.com/cardigann/cardigann/torznab"
)
type Result struct {
ReleaseName string `json:"release_name"`
TorrentID string `json:"torrent_id"`
DetailsURL string `json:"details_url"`
DownloadURL string `json:"download_url"`
ImdbID string `json:"imdb_id"`
Freeleech bool `json:"freeleech"`
Type string `json:"type"`
Size int `json:"size"`
Leechers int `json:"leechers"`
Seeders int `json:"seeders"`
}
type Results struct {
Results []Result `json:"results"`
TotalResults int `json:"total_results"`
}
func Error(w http.ResponseWriter, err error) {
b, err := json.MarshalIndent(map[string]string{"error": err.Error()}, "", " ")
if err != nil {
panic(err)
}
w.Header().Set("Content-Type", "application/json; charset=UTF-8")
w.WriteHeader(http.StatusBadGateway)
w.Write(append(b, '\n'))
}
func Output(w http.ResponseWriter, items []torznab.ResultItem) {
results := []Result{}
for _, item := range items {
results = append(results, Result{
ReleaseName: item.Title,
TorrentID: item.GUID,
DetailsURL: item.Comments,
DownloadURL: item.Link,
Type: "movie",
Size: int(item.Size / 1024 / 1024),
Leechers: item.Peers - item.Seeders,
Seeders: item.Seeders,
})
}
res := Results{results, len(results)}
b, err := json.MarshalIndent(res, "", " ")
if err != nil {
Error(w, err)
return
}
w.Header().Set("Content-Type", "application/json; charset=UTF-8")
w.Write(append(b, '\n'))
}
